Platform
Features
Pricing
Novacoast
HQ
Novacoast's headquarters in Santa Barbara, CA, United States
Chief Technical Officer
Chief Security Officer
President And Chief Administrative Officer
Director Of Corporate Trade Shows
VP Of Technology
Director - Security Services
Chief Legal Officer
Executive Administrator
Director Of Advisory And Success / Chief Of Strategic Initiatives
No jobs in this office